Understanding The HDMI Port And Cable Types On A Dynex TV

When it comes to connecting HDMI to your Dynex TV, it is essential to first understand the HDMI port and cable types. Dynex TVs typically feature one or more HDMI ports, which are rectangular in shape and labeled as “HDMI” on the back or side of the TV.

HDMI cables are essential for transmitting both high-definition video and audio signals from your source devices to the TV. There are several types of HDMI cables, including Standard HDMI, High-Speed HDMI, and Premium High-Speed HDMI. The type you choose depends on the resolution and capabilities of your Dynex TV and source devices.

Standard HDMI cables support resolutions up to 1080p, making them suitable for older devices or non-4K TVs. High-Speed HDMI cables support resolutions up to 4K and are commonly used for modern TVs and source devices. Premium High-Speed HDMI cables offer similar capabilities but also support features like HDR (High Dynamic Range) and Enhanced Audio Return Channel (eARC).

Understanding the HDMI port and cable types is crucial for successfully connecting HDMI devices to your Dynex TV and ensuring optimal video and audio performance.

Step 3: Connecting HDMI Sources (e.g., Cable Box, DVD Player) To Your Dynex TV

Connecting HDMI sources to your Dynex TV is a straightforward process that involves a few simple steps. By following the instructions below, you can easily connect your cable box, DVD player, or other HDMI devices to enjoy high-quality audio and video on your Dynex TV.

To start, locate the HDMI ports on your Dynex TV. These ports are typically labeled “HDMI” and are usually located on the back or sides of the TV. Once you’ve found the HDMI ports, take note of their number or position.

Next, connect one end of the HDMI cable to the HDMI output port on your cable box or DVD player. Make sure to insert the cable securely to ensure a proper connection.

After that, connect the other end of the HDMI cable to one of the HDMI input ports on your Dynex TV. Again, ensure a secure and tight connection.

Once everything is connected, turn on your TV and the HDMI source device. Use the Dynex TV remote control to navigate to the input/source menu and select the corresponding HDMI input port you connected the source device to.

Troubleshooting Common HDMI Connection Issues On A Dynex TV

In some cases, you may encounter issues while trying to connect HDMI to your Dynex TV. These problems can range from no signal being displayed to audio or video distortion. However, with a few troubleshooting steps, you can resolve most of these common HDMI connection issues.

Firstly, ensure that all the HDMI cables are securely connected on both the TV and the source device. Sometimes, loose connections can lead to a lack of signal. Additionally, make sure that the HDMI ports on both the TV and the source device are free from any debris or physical damage.

If the connection issue persists, try using a different HDMI cable. Faulty cables can cause connectivity problems, so testing with a known-working cable is a good way to identify the root cause.

It’s also important to check if the HDMI input on your Dynex TV is correctly selected. Using your TV’s remote control, navigate to the input/source settings and ensure that the corresponding HDMI input is selected.

If you’re experiencing distorted audio or video, it could be due to compatibility issues between the source device and the TV. In such cases, consult the user manuals of both devices to verify if they support the same HDMI standard.

Lastly, consider power cycling both the TV and the source device. Turn off both devices, unplug them from the power source, wait for a few minutes, and then reconnect and power them back on. This simple step can sometimes resolve connectivity issues.

By following these troubleshooting steps, you should be able to overcome most common HDMI connection issues on your Dynex TV and enjoy an uninterrupted viewing experience.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. How do I identify the HDMI input on my Dynex TV?

To locate the HDMI input on your Dynex TV, look for the HDMI label on the back or side panel of the TV. It is usually accompanied by a number indicating the HDMI port, such as HDMI 1 or HDMI 2.

2. Can I connect multiple devices to my Dynex TV using HDMI?

Absolutely! Dynex TVs typically come with multiple HDMI inputs, allowing you to connect multiple devices simultaneously. Simply connect each device’s HDMI cable to a separate HDMI port on the TV and use the TV remote to select the desired input.

3. What type of HDMI cable do I need to connect my devices to a Dynex TV?

To connect your devices to a Dynex TV, you will need a standard HDMI cable. There are different versions of HDMI cables (e.g., HDMI 1.4, HDMI 2.0), but most Dynex TVs support various HDMI versions and will work with any standard HDMI cable.

4. Do I need to change any settings on my Dynex TV after connecting an HDMI cable?

In most cases, there is no need to change any settings on your Dynex TV after connecting an HDMI cable. Once the cable is connected and both devices are powered on, the Dynex TV should automatically recognize the HDMI input and display the content from your device. If not, you may need to use the TV remote to navigate to the correct HDMI input manually.

5. Can I use HDMI to connect my laptop or computer to a Dynex TV?

Yes, you can use HDMI to connect your laptop or computer to a Dynex TV. Simply connect one end of the HDMI cable to the HDMI output port on your laptop or computer, and the other end to an available HDMI input on the Dynex TV. Then, change the input source on the TV to the respective HDMI port, and your laptop or computer screen should be mirrored or extended to the TV.
